Description

This is a 2009 Mac Pro upgraded to 5,1 with a 6 core 3.33 ghz Westmere processor (x5680). Includes the following: 512 MB GeForce GT 120 24gb ddr3 etc RAM at 1333mhz 240gb Samsung 830 SSD bolt drive with High Sierra 1TB Samsung hard drive A DVD/Cd drive (write and read) There are cosmetic issues that I tried to include through the attached pictures. Scratches and weird burn marks that do not impact the system. Not the original owner but have been using the machine flawlessly since 2014. The biggest issue is that the back bottom footing is bent slightly (it was damaged when it was originally shipped to me). I put a furniture scratch pad as seen on the pictures to help balance the machine so it’s not slanted. There has been no impact to the machine due to this.
